phonography ::: field recording ::: the art of sound-hunting ::: open your ears and listen framework radio
  • #971: 2026.05.10 [marcos fernandes]
    this week we conclude for this year our look back at some classic editions of framework:afield, never before online and not heard since their initial broadcasts almost 20 years ago. this week, an edition produced by japanese native longtime u.s. resident musician, marcos fernandes. titled ready for the revolution, it […]
